Guardians Claim Ramon Laureano off Waivers

On Monday, the Cleveland Guardians picked up 29-year-old outfielder Ramon Laureano off outright waivers from the Oakland Athletics. Laureano is now under club control with the Guardians through the 2025 season. They will also pick up the remainder of Laureano’s owed salary this season of $3.55 million.
